Current Sensor Market Share to grow at a CAGR of 10.8% by 2026
The Global Current Sensor Market is expected to grow from USD 2.3 billion in 2021 to USD 3.8 billion by 2026; it is expected to grow at a CAGR of 10.8% during 2021–2026. Key factors fueling this markets growth include growing use of battery-powered systems and increasing focus on renewable energy, high adoption of Hall-effect current sensors, and increasing demand in consumer electronics industry. Deployment of IoT and IIoT with current sensors and increasing manufacturing of hybrid and electric cars create a strong demand for current sensor for efficient industrial operations in the midst of COVID-19.
